    • A node for self localization, a clustering method using the same, and a localization method are provided. The node, which is located in a specific space so as to constitute a sensor network, includes a location information messaging unit which receives one or more location information messages including information on spatial locations of one or more neighboring nodes in the sensor network from the neighboring nodes in the sensor network; a distance calculator which calculates a first distance to the neighboring node on the basis of the location information included in the received location information messages and calculates a second distance to one or more neighboring nodes on the basis of the received time or intensity of the message on the location information; and a clustering unit which forms clusters of the node and a plurality of neighboring nodes in which the difference between the first and second distances is less than a predetermined threshold.

    • Provided are a coordinator in a wireless sensor network (WSN) which can improve transmission performance and prevent data loss, and a method of operating the coordinator. The method includes: scanning a transmitted beacon and storing information on a channel included in the beacon; when it is determined that a home channel communicating with a parent node is in an inactive mode on the basis of the information on the channel, in synchronization with the activation of another channel of the same hierarchical level as that of the home channel, activating a home channel communicating with a child node and communicating with the child node; and communicating with the child node through an auxiliary channel that has a frequency band different from those of the home channel communicating with the child node and home channels of other nodes and is always in an active mode.

    • Provided is a method and system for hierarchically communicating information between a user and an information providing server that provides information requested by the user. The system includes at least one sensor node, upon receipt of an information request message sent by the user through a terminal, searching for information corresponding to the information request message in a first cache mounted therein and sending the information request message if the corresponding information is not found in the first cache, and a cache server, upon receipt of the information request message from the at least one sensor node, searching for the information corresponding to the information request message in a second cache mounted therein, sending the information request message to the information providing server if the corresponding information is not found in the second cache, receiving the corresponding information, transmitting the received information to the sensor node, and updating the second cache.
